Im Mel Montoya, a Barcelona-based illustrator originally from Medellín, creating childrens illustration and story-driven visual worlds.

As a child, every Saturday morning I would wake up before everyone else, gather my paints, egg cartons, and anything I could find, and start making. I grew up with a deep need to create with my hands.

My path first led me through Industrial Design and UX Design, with studies across the USA and Argentina. But the urge to paint never left me, and eventually brought me back to illustration, where I continue to learn and grow my practice.

Many of my ideas begin in dreams, in nature, and in the need to express emotion. Through color, narrative, and gentle humor, I build expressive scenes and meaningful stories.

Im especially drawn to picture books, editorial illustration, and playful product concepts, often developing my own stories along the way. For me, each morning is a new chance to observe, absorb, and shape something new.
